Fish and Chips to return to Abingdon town centre

Singin in the Rain
There has been no Fish and Chips in Abingdon town centre since the Lemon Place and then Smarts closed.

Fish and Chips is a great British Institution, that has taken a battering over the last 40 years with the arrival of pizza, burgers, and kebabs. There will be Abingdon Fish & Chips, where the Chinese Kitchen closed last year. The new blue sign went up last week along with the pictures of Cod and Plaice and Scampi.
